**Vendor note: Inkmill markdown pipeline**

Rendering for Parchway docs is outsourced to Inkmill under an annual contract, renewing each March. They handle sanitization and PDF export; we own the upload queue. SLA: 4-hour response on rendering failures. Escalate only after two failed retries. Their support desk is reachable at the address below.

billing contact of hahaf-baguf = zorael.tammir.jorius@sivrelhq.internal

Ticket: Webhook retry config vault locked after three failed unseal attempts. Retries for Mossgate deliveries use exponential backoff capped at six attempts; changing that requires the sealed policy file. No evidence of tampering in audit trail. To unseal and restore delivery semantics, use the recovery passphrase below.

recovery phrase for fahif-hadup: sorix-holael

# Build Provenance: Idempotency Keys in Pennywhistle Retries

The Pennywhistle payment service derives idempotency keys from the order hash plus attempt epoch, so a retried charge never double-settles. If on-call sees duplicate settlements, first verify the gateway is running a build that includes the key-derivation fix — older builds salted keys per-process, breaking dedup across restarts. Confirm the deployed artifact against the provenance token recorded below.

trace token, fafog-kageg: htk4_98e6